Description
The Construction Manager – Senior MEP Inspector will lead inspection efforts for various vertical/facility/building projects, the majority of which are aviation related.
They will inspect ongoing construction for adherence to project drawings and specifications with experience in building construction, mechanical, electrical, plumbing (MEP), and fire protection.
They will ensure junior inspection staff's proper delivery of overall project execution and documentation related to quality assurance including, but not limited to: Contractor construction materials, quantities, personnel, site conditions, safety, etc.
The primary duty of the Construction Manager – Senior MEP Inspector is to serve as a key member/representative of the firm's growing construction services discipline.
You will be expected to:
Maintain supervision of site inspections for 1 to 3 vertical/MEP related projects and report to the Resident Engineer.
Review plans and specifications associated with assigned work on active construction contracts.
Oversee daily operations of contractor or subcontractor personnel to ensure that work is being performed in accordance with plans and specifications.
Identify contractor means and methods that are inconsistent with plans and specifications, and discuss needed changes with the contractor as well as the Resident Engineer
Make measurements and observations of work being performed to ensure accurate quantities are tracked for completed work.
Attend pre-installation meetings and identify potential issues with installation before they occur.
Prepare daily reports including labor, equipment, materials, safety, etc.
Photo document all project activities
